only show battle mode in multiplayer mode

git-svn-id: svn+ssh://svn.code.sf.net/p/supertuxkart/code/trunk/supertuxkart@2578 178a84e3-b1eb-0310-8ba1-8eac791a3b58
This commit is contained in:
auria 2008-12-08 01:31:46 +00:00
parent 66859e11e9
commit d1d8a71e30

View File

@ -78,19 +78,20 @@ GameMode::GameMode()
w->setPosition(column_1_dir, column_1_loc, NULL,
WGT_DIR_UNDER_WIDGET, 0.0f, w_prev);
w_prev=w;
w=widget_manager->addTextButtonWgt(WTOK_3_STRIKES_SINGLE, WIDTH, HEIGHT,
_("3 Strikes Battle"));
w->setPosition(column_1_dir, column_1_loc, NULL,
WGT_DIR_UNDER_WIDGET, 0.0f, w_prev);
w_prev=w;
widget_manager->sameWidth(WTOK_TITLE_SINGLE, WTOK_3_STRIKES_SINGLE);
// don't activate battle mode in single-player mode
if(race_manager->getNumLocalPlayers()==1 &&
network_manager->getMode()==NetworkManager::NW_NONE)
widget_manager->deactivateWgt(WTOK_3_STRIKES_SINGLE);
if(race_manager->getNumLocalPlayers()>1 ||
network_manager->getMode()!=NetworkManager::NW_NONE)
{
w=widget_manager->addTextButtonWgt(WTOK_3_STRIKES_SINGLE, WIDTH, HEIGHT,
_("3 Strikes Battle"));
w->setPosition(column_1_dir, column_1_loc, NULL,
WGT_DIR_UNDER_WIDGET, 0.0f, w_prev);
w_prev=w;
widget_manager->sameWidth(WTOK_TITLE_SINGLE, WTOK_3_STRIKES_SINGLE);
}
else
widget_manager->activateWgt(WTOK_3_STRIKES_SINGLE);
widget_manager->sameWidth(WTOK_TITLE_SINGLE, WTOK_FOLLOW_LEADER_SINGLE);
// Then the GPs
// ============